Not many of us inherit this type of soil (wouldn’t that be awesome!), most of us begin on hard, dry, poor, barren or minerally imbalanced ground. Our job, as gardeners, is to steadily transform it. It takes a bit of time but its not at all difficult, and it’s such a thrill!
Your end goal is a living soil. A home for millions of microscopic life forms – protozoa, fungi, bacteria, nematodes, arthropods, worms… the invisible workforce that takes care of everything (yes! everything!), plants + trees, need to be productive and well:
The more diverse the soil life, the less pest + disease and the better the cropping = your easy garden life!
So, get to know your soil! It’s at the heart of being a food gardener.
Don’t rely on lab tests alone, do it in real time, in the very best of ways, by regularly testing with your hands and eyes and nose.
